How to download previous version of Elements to new Mac? [was: janiner15]

I've been using photoshop elements on my mac for years. I just bought a new macbook pro and adobe isnt recognizing that i already own photoshop elements. Adobe is making me sign in for a 30 day trial with option to purchase but i already boughh it years ago. Any advice? Did they change it to a yearly subscription only??

You only have a license to the version of photoshop elements you had bought for your older mac.

If you install a different/newer version, then yes you would need to purchase it.

What version of photoshop elements is on your older mac?

You can download the version you own (and only that version) from Adobe:

Download Photoshop Elements | 2018, 15, and 14

Download Photoshop Elements 13, 12, 11, 10, 9, 8, and 7

Install then enter your serial number.
